Magisterial District Court Secretary

Prepares a variety of legal forms and documents including criminal/civil complaints, warrants, subpoenas, bonds, commitments, notices, etc.
- Files and dockets citations, complaints, and all actions taken in each case.
- Processes certified mailings of criminal/civil complaints, court orders, etc.
- Answers telephone inquiries and directs callers to appropriate individual.
- Schedules hearings and appointments and maintains court calendar.
- Collects fines and cots and makes appropriate recording, posting, and recordkeeping for same. Writes checks and makes bank deposits as required.
- Prepares reports as required.
- Enters data in computer; types various forms, reports, and correspondence.
- Proficient in both county and state computer system.
- Maintains up-to-date manuals for department use.
- Orders office supplies for department as needed.
- Interacts with other County offices as necessary.
- Directs clients to courtroom or other county offices.
- Performs other job related duties as required.

**Qualifications**:
Required Education: High school diploma or equivalent And some business/clerical training, including computers. Required Experience: Two (2) years working experience in legal environment, or experience in government preferred.
